SB 390
Kansas Senate Bill

House Substitute for SB 390 by Committee on Agriculture and Natural Resources - Prohibiting certain additives in food provided by schools as part of certain federal food service programs and permitting federal pesticide warning or labeling requirements to satisfy any state pesticide warning or labeling requirements.

Actions
  • Mar 18, 2026 | House
    • Committee of the Whole - Passed over and retain a place on the calendar
  • Mar 17, 2026 | House
    • Committee Report recommending substitute bill be passed by Committee on Agriculture and Natural Resources
  • Mar 11, 2026 | House
    • Hearing: Wednesday, March 11, 2026, 3:30 PM Room 112-N
  • Feb 24, 2026 | House
    • Received and Introduced
    • Referred to Committee on Agriculture and Natural Resources
  • Feb 18, 2026 | Senate
    • Final Action - Passed as amended; Yea: 40 Nay: 0
  • Feb 17, 2026 | Senate
    • Committee of the Whole - Committee Report be adopted
    • Committee of the Whole - Be passed as amended
  • Feb 11, 2026 | Senate
    • Committee Report recommending bill be passed as amended by Committee on Agriculture and Natural Resources
  • Jan 28, 2026 | Senate
    • Referred to Committee on Government Efficiency
    • Withdrawn from Committee on Government Efficiency; Referred to Committee on Agriculture and Natural Resources
  • Jan 27, 2026 | Senate
    • Introduced
